上海品茶

您的当前位置: 上海品茶 > 上海品茶 > 行业知识 > 什么叫做devops平台化?核心组成部分有哪些?

什么叫做devops平台化?核心组成部分有哪些?

DevOps平台化是指将DevOps方法论和技术工具整合到一起,构建一个可扩展、可定制的DevOps平台,以支持持续集成、持续交付、自动化测试和部署等DevOps流程。这篇文章将从不同方面详细分析DevOps平台化的定义、意义、核心组成部分、应用场景和未来发展趋势等方面。

一、DevOps平台化的定义和意义

随着软件开发的快速迭代和云计算、容器化、微服务等技术的普及,DevOps已经成为企业IT部门的重要组成部分。DevOps平台化是指将DevOps方法论和技术工具整合到一起,构建一个可扩展、可定制的DevOps平台,以支持持续集成、持续交付、自动化测试和部署等DevOps流程。DevOps平台化的意义在于,将DevOps的最佳实践和自动化工具整合在一起,提高软件交付效率和质量,降低软件交付风险,进而实现业务的快速响应和创新。

二、DevOps平台化的核心组成部分

DevOps平台化的核心组成部分包括:

自动化工具:自动化工具是DevOps平台化的核心,包括代码构建、测试、部署和监控等环节的自动化工具,如Jenkins、Travis CI、GitLab等。

配置管理工具:配置管理工具是DevOps平台化的重要组成部分,包括服务器配置、应用程序配置等的管理工具,如Ansible、Puppet、Chef等。

容器技术:容器技术是DevOps平台化的重要技术支撑,如Docker、Kubernetes等,能够实现软件的快速部署和扩展。

监控工具:监控工具是DevOps平台化的重要组成部分,包括应用程序监控、网络监控、日志监控等,如Nagios、Zabbix、ELK等。

DevOps文化:DevOps平台化的实现需要打破传统的开发和运维之间的隔离,需要推崇DevOps文化,包括协作、持续交付和自动化等最佳实践。

三、DevOps平台化的应用场景

DevOps平台化在以下场景中得到广泛应用:

云原生应用开发:随着云计算和容器化技术的普及,云原生应用开发需要快速迭代和自动化部署,DevOps平台化能够支持持续交付、自动化部署和灰度发布等功能,大幅度提高云原生应用的开发效率和质量。

大规模微服务架构:随着微服务架构的普及,单体应用拆分成为多个微服务,需要进行协同开发和部署。DevOps平台化能够支持多个微服务的自动化部署和集成测试,大幅度提高微服务架构的开发效率和质量。

IoT应用开发:随着物联网技术的发展,IoT应用需要实时监测和响应,需要进行自动化部署和快速迭代。DevOps平台化能够支持IoT应用的自动化部署和持续集成,大幅度提高IoT应用的开发效率和质量。

移动应用开发:随着移动互联网的普及,移动应用需要快速迭代和自动化部署。DevOps平台化能够支持移动应用的自动化打包、发布和测试,大幅度提高移动应用的开发效率和质量。

数据中心自动化:随着企业IT系统的规模不断扩大,数据中心需要进行自动化部署和运维,DevOps平台化能够支持自动化部署、自动化监控和自动化运维等功能,大幅度提高数据中心的效率和稳定性。

四、DevOps平台化的优势

DevOps平台化的优势主要体现在以下几个方面:

提高效率:DevOps平台化能够实现自动化部署、持续集成和持续交付等功能,大幅度提高软件开发和部署的效率,从而提高企业的竞争力。

提高质量:DevOps平台化能够实现持续集成、自动化测试和持续部署等功能,大幅度提高软件的质量和稳定性,从而降低企业的风险和成本。

提高灵活性:DevOps平台化能够支持快速迭代和自动化部署等功能,提高企业的灵活性和应变能力,从而更好地适应市场的变化和客户需求。

高协作性:DevOps平台化能够支持不同团队之间的协作,包括开发团队、测试团队和运维团队等,从而提高整个团队的效率和质量。

降低成本:DevOps平台化能够自动化部署和测试等环节,减少人工干预和出错的风险,从而降低企业的成本。

优化用户体验:DevOps平台化能够快速响应客户需求,实现快速迭代和自动化部署等功能,从而提高用户体验和客户满意度。

五、总结

随着互联网和移动互联网的快速发展,企业需要更快、更好、更便捷地实现软件开发和部署。DevOps平台化作为一种软件开发和部署的新模式,具有自动化、协作、持续集成、持续交付等优势,可以大幅度提高软件开发和部署的效率和质量,从而提高企业的竞争力和创新能力。

在实际应用中,企业需要根据自身的业务和需求,选择合适的DevOps平台化解决方案,并进行有效的实施和管理。只有充分利用DevOps平台化的优势,才能更好地满足客户需求和市场变化,实现企业的可持续发展。

本文标签

本文由作者C-C发布,版权归原作者所有,禁止转载。本文仅代表作者个人观点,与本网无关。本文文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。

相关报告

秒针营销科学院&amp虎啸奖组委会:2020中国数字营销系列图谱解读(44页).pdf
秒针营销科学院&amp虎啸奖组委会:2020中国数字营销系列图谱解读(44页).pdf

 内容板块资源解读虽然笔者自认为是左脑的数字营销人,但是内心相信营销的魅力来自内窑和创意,广告主在数字营销上投入的庞大预算只是实现了目标受众的触达,而最终感动消费者引发转化的,或者说解决营销问题的还是内容和创意。但是目前在五种数字营销的资源中,内容是数字化程度最低的资源,大部分的内容生产仍然来回撒字化的匠人模 

第四届未来网络发展大会组委会:全球未来网络发展白皮书(2020版)(116页).pdf
第四届未来网络发展大会组委会:全球未来网络发展白皮书(2020版)(116页).pdf

 当今时代,互联网与人们生活、学习、工作融为一体,互联网成为了人类历史上最重要的基础设施之一。经过 50 年的发展,互联网从最初的科研型网络发展成消费型网络,目前正向生产型网络转变。2020 年互联网正式进入下半场,未来网络迎来新的机遇。互联网发展至今,涌现出一系列优秀的技术,如 TCP/IP、OSPF、BG

第五届未来网络发展大会组委会:未来网络白皮书——确定性网络技术体系(104页).pdf
第五届未来网络发展大会组委会:未来网络白皮书——确定性网络技术体系(104页).pdf

 工业无线网络应用广泛的标准技术如 WirelessHART、WIA-PA和 ISA100.11a,都不能同时提供工业控制所需的极低时延和高可靠性通信。为使无线网络满足时间敏感业务的传输要求,目前主流的方法是设计无线网络中的实时传输调度方法,将端到端的实时传输时延问题建立成具有时延限制的数学模型,再进行分析求

2021全球文旅住宿产业博览会组委会:2021中国文旅住宿流量生态白皮书(226页).pdf
2021全球文旅住宿产业博览会组委会:2021中国文旅住宿流量生态白皮书(226页).pdf

 中国旅游业是第三产业的主要支柱行业,旅游业在调整产业结构、缩小区域发展差距、创造就业机会等方面具有明显的优势,国家近年来持续出台多项旅游业利好政策,疫情初期限制旅游以合理管控疫情,在疫情得到控制后,地方和中央政府相继出台相关政策恢复并加快发展旅游业。政策的引导和支持是中国文旅住宿产业发展的关键驱动力,政府出

QTF量化科技嘉年华组委会:2023量化科技白皮书.pdf
QTF量化科技嘉年华组委会:2023量化科技白皮书.pdf

 在计算机体系、软件技术和算法理论的共同推动下,量化技术得到了飞速发展。从 20 世纪 50 年代,美国商品期货市场开始采用电子交易平台,到 90 年代互联网促进各种自动化交易系统、智能匹配算法和高效交易策略的出现,再到 21 世纪以来大数据、人工智能和云计算等金融科技的广泛应用,美国金融市场已成为世界上规模

会员购买
客服

专属顾问

商务合作

机构入驻、侵权投诉、商务合作

服务号

三个皮匠报告官方公众号

回到顶部